Revenue bonds, municipalities, refunding issue authorized--formand terms.

100.155. 1. Any municipality which has revenue bonds issuedpursuant to the provisions of sections 100.010 to 100.200 mayissue refunding revenue bonds to provide funds to refund any orall of such revenue bonds, including payment of unpaid interest,premiums and other expenses connected therewith, whether thebonds to be refunded have or have not matured. The form of suchrefunding revenue bonds, and the terms under which such refundingrevenue bonds may be issued, including the number of the yearswithin which they are to be redeemed and their interest rate orrates, which interest rate or rates may be less than, the same,or greater than that of the revenue bonds being refunded, shallbe specified by the ordinance, order, indenture or resolutionauthorizing the refunding bonds. Refunding under the provisionsof this section may be effected by a private or public sale ofthe refunding revenue bonds, and the application of the proceedsto the purchase, redemption or payment of the revenue bonds to berefunded, or by an exchange of the refunding revenue bonds forthe revenue bonds being refunded with the consent of the holderor holders of the revenue bonds being refunded. The refundingrevenue bonds shall be paid solely from revenue received from theproject or projects financed by the revenue bonds being refunded,and shall not be a general obligation of the municipality.

2. Any municipality proposing to issue refunding revenuebonds shall issue those bonds pursuant to the provisions ofsections 100.010 to 100.200.

(L. 1981 S.B. 250 §§ 1, 2, A.L. 1983 S.B. 316)

Effective 6-22-83
